Metal Evaporation Materials Market Forecast 2025-2034
Metal evaporation materials play a crucial role in various industries, including electronics, automotive, aerospace, and more. These materials are used in a wide range of applications, such as coating, thin film deposition, and semiconductor manufacturing. With the increasing demand for high-quality, high-performance materials, the metal evaporation materials market is expected to experience significant growth in the coming years.
The metal evaporation materials market is segmented by product type, including aluminum, titanium, and gold. Each of these materials offers unique properties and benefits that make them ideal for specific applications. Aluminum, for example, is lightweight and corrosion-resistant, making it a popular choice for automotive and aerospace industries. Titanium is known for its high strength-to-weight ratio, making it suitable for medical implants and aircraft components. Gold is highly conductive and does not tarnish, making it crucial for electronics and jewelry manufacturing.
One of the key drivers of the metal evaporation materials market is the increasing demand for advanced electronic devices. As consumer electronics become more sophisticated and compact, the need for high-performance materials in manufacturing processes is on the rise. Metal evaporation materials are essential for producing microchips, LEDs, and other electronic components that require precise and reliable performance.
In addition to electronics, the automotive industry is another major consumer of metal evaporation materials. With the growing trend towards lightweight vehicles for improved fuel efficiency, manufacturers are turning to materials like aluminum and titanium to reduce overall weight without compromising on strength and durability. Metal evaporation materials are also used in coatings for automotive parts to enhance aesthetics and protect against corrosion.
The aerospace industry is yet another important sector driving the growth of the metal evaporation materials market. Aerospace components must withstand extreme conditions, including high temperatures, pressure, and exposure to chemicals. Titanium and other high-performance metals are preferred for their strength, durability, and resistance to corrosion, making them essential for aircraft manufacturing and maintenance.
